In PLC programming, load, transfer, and move instructions are commonly used to handle data movement between memory locations. These operations can be executed in different data sizes such as bytes, words, or double words, depending on the specific application. Each instruction has a unique role: - **Load**: This instruction is used to copy the contents of a memory location or a specific value into the accumulator or address register. - **Transfer**: It moves the data stored in the accumulator or address register to a designated memory location. - **Move**: This operation transfers data from one memory location or a direct value to another. The exact implementation of these instructions may vary across different PLC models, such as S7-200, S7-300, and S7-400. Each model supports different types of data movement instructions, which are typically detailed in technical manuals or programming guides. Understanding the differences between these instructions is essential for efficient and accurate PLC programming.
